Transaction 463a2687916322c2d537961fa3f69a8af4c31c73f7c25517cad9a9177ebf0968
1 Input
1 Output
-
463a2687916322c2d537961fa3f69a8af4c31c73f7c25517cad9a9177ebf0968:0
- value
- 996836
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 72be2044389c31aee388098d6eeb05202988c65b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BTho4LiUQX4VCsQZ4oFcq7zMAedVvYLUt